Accident summary

On Saturday 28 September 2024 at 19:10 a fatal collision occurred near M40, Stratford-upon-Avon involving 6 vehicles and 3 casualties (1 serious, 1 fatal, 1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as darkness - no lighting. A police officer attended the scene.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 70 mph
  • Road type: Dual carriageway
  • Setting: Rural
